Load Cell Mount Installation

11

3. Trim sheet metal as needed for clearance around any vertical gussets in the support beams and around the

manhole on the cross beams. Figure 3-9 shows the metal sheeting used on a EZ-SR truck scale installation.

Figure 3-9. Metal sheeting example.

Secure the corrugated metal sheet to the manhole frame by installing 12 sheet metal screws (or tack weld)
around base of manhole frame.

When pouring concrete, make sure that concrete is poured over the overlap not into the overlap.

3.6

Deck Rebar

Concrete deck reinforcing consists of installing #5 rebar on 12" centers at the locations shown on the drawing
along with using standard construction practices.

At the installer’s discretion, rebar may or may not be tied together.

The first (bottom) layer of rebar installation consist of positioning 6'-3" rebars perpendicular to the main beams and
on 1-1/2" chairs (bolsters) located on top of the corrugated sheet metal. On top of this rebar layer, a second layer
(70' rebar) is installed perpendicular to the first layer and parallel to the main beam.

The third layer will be the 2' rebar placed on chairs. On top of these will be another layer of 70' rebar running the
length of the frame assembly.

The final two layers will require installing 9'-4' rebar on the appropriate chairs. On this will be the top layer of 70'
rebar.
